ALEXANDRIA, Va., July 7 -- United States Patent no. 12,676,215, issued on July 7, was assigned to Genentech Inc. (South San Francisco, Calif.) and Hoffmann-La Roche Inc. (Little Falls, N.J.).
"Model routing and robust outlier detection" was invented by Muhammad Mamduh Bin Ahmad Zabidi (Subang Jaya, Malaysia), Nandini Chitale (Cupertino, Calif.) and Michael Paul Dandrea (South San Francisco, Calif.).
